Reporting themes and items
| No. | Employee benefits, health and well-being (EHW) | Diversity andequity (DE) | Climate change (CC) | Responsible production and consumption (RPC)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Unions or collective bargaining for protecting workers’ rights | Gender diversity in employment metrics | Specify business risks of climate change | Total materials used (weight or volume) |
| 2 | Employee training and skill upgrade | Age diversity in employment metrics | Climate risk and impact mitigation plans | Use of renewable materials |
| 3 | Employee benefits | Age equity in training and education opportunities | Governance - Role of board and/or management in climate change | Use of recycled materials as inputs |
| 4 | Employee health service (insurance and/or medical facilities) | Equal parental leave entitlements and shared responsibility | Climate risk management process | Total waste generated |
| 5 | Work-related injuries data | Gender equity in training and education opportunities | Energy consumption statistics | Breakdown on waste and material flows (recycling, landfill, incineration, etc) |
| 6 | Work-related ill health data | Gender remuneration metrics or statement | Energy from renewable sources | Use of reclaimed products and packaging materials metrics |
| 7 | OHS system (including workers covered by the system) | Gender diversity in leadership | Energy intensity ratio | Waste generation activities |
| 8 | Employee OHS consultation (including joint committees) | Age diversity in leadership | Reduction of energy consumption | Actions taken to reduce waste generation |
| 9 | Provision of OHS training | Legal actions or complaints on discrimination | Direct (scope 1) GHG emissions | Product and service labelling concerning environmental impacts and/or disposal |
| 10 | Minimum notice period given to employees prior to significant operational changes | Indirect (scope 2) GHG emissions | ||
| 11 | Work-related hazards and risk management processes | GHG emissions intensity | ||
| 12 | Prevention and mitigation of work-related injuries | Reduction of GHG emissions | ||
| 13 | Prevention and mitigation of work-related ill-health (non-Covid) | Non-GHG emissions | ||
| 14 | Covid prevention and mitigation | Emissions reduction targets | ||
| 15 | Energy outside of the organisation - supply chain energy metrics | |||
| 16 | Reduction of energy required for customer use | |||
| 17 | Other indirect (scope 3) GHG emissions |
